EEC 的意思是引擎電子控制 (Electronic
Engine Control),是福特用來控制車輛功能的電子監理電腦系統,大家不要以家用電腦的角度來想像這
EEC, 這可是一個不會當機和幾乎是不需要去注意的電腦。自 1978 年起,福特開始在其產製的車上搭載入EEC系統,一直到今日已經有八個版本的
EEC 電腦了,茲介紹如下:
EEC-I
自 1978 年啟用,控制項目包括點火正時、EGR系統及排煙泵普。
EEC-II
自 1979 年啟用,控制項目包括含氧訊號反饋、燃油泵普、點火正時、EGR
系統及排煙泵普。
EEC-III
自 1980 年啟用,控制項目包括完整的燃油噴射中央控制系統(無自測功能)。
EEC-IV
自 1984 年啟用,控制項目包括 OBD-I
系統。
EEC-VI
具備先進的程式編程功能,幾乎可在任何引擎上運作,包含所有引擎運作需要的控制功能,
像是空污排放控制及其附屬設備,都能很輕鬆的處理。
EEC-IV 和 EEC-III
一樣使用 60pin 的連接器,但連接器的尺寸不同。

EEC-V v1.0
自 1994 年啟用,控制項目包括 OBD-II
系統。

EEC-V v2.0
自 1999 年啟用,控制項目包括 OBD-II
系統,並有完整的快閃記憶體。

EEC-VI
自 2001 年啟用,進化為 32Bit
系統架構

福特與旗下的 Visteon
集團開發了內部相當複雜的 EEC 電腦,EEC
系統內部有三種不同的記憶體,分別是 ROM、KAM
及 RAM。
ROM 主要是儲存主控制程式之處,當 EEC
電腦斷電之後,ROM 中儲存的程式約可維持
20 年左右。
KAM 儲存著複雜的中期記憶,包含故障碼及各感知器的預設值,當斷電後記憶在
KAM 中的資料便會消失。
RAM 用來持續儲存短期的旅途變化記憶,當鑰匙電門關閉後便會被清除。
處理器則管理著整個系統中,由工廠預設的燃油噴射程式以及指揮著整個控制系統,程式內部包含著標定量、副程式、資料表及控制流程。
標定量是一個唯一的數值標記,也比它實際聽來更為複雜
舉個較容易瞭解的例子:斷油轉速限制:REVLIM = 6000rpm
副程式基本上是一個趨勢圖,但福特喜歡把他稱之為副程式,這通常是輸入與輸出的對應,故有更多輸入便會導致更多的輸出,反之亦然。
資料表是 3-D 立體變化的,當二個訊號輸入同時影響一個控制輸出時,還會比副程式更為複雜,控制流程是結合基本的標定量、副程式和資料表之後,由程式來計算控制輸出,這部分便較為容易讓人去理解了。

不同年份的車型、引擎及變速箱都會有著不同的程式參數,但控制流程是永久被燒錄於處理器內而不可變的,這些標定量、副程式、資料表也是無法被替換的,但卻可以藉由改裝晶片來替代其內的數值,稍後再說明這個部分。
在 EEC
電腦中會有一或二個控制流程,實際的流程比前述的簡單範例要複雜很多,控制流程結合並創制了全部的系統運行策略,第二個控制流程則可在車上增加自排箱的控制,控制流程在
EEC 內以超高的速度在運行著,EEC 電腦中主要的運行策略是用來運轉引擎,反饋的運行策略則是用做空污控制及診斷之用,在每個運行策略中,主要的查檢資料表都必須用到
PIP、TPS、ECT、MAF
或 MAP....等感知器,這些感知器運轉並顯示著
EEC 電腦中控制流程指揮的結果,下面這張圖表說明著關於供油、點火時機及空污控制的相關運行策略。

EEC-V:
EEC-V 和 EEC-IV
在很多部分都相當類似, EEC-V
的運算速度更快也具有更多控制能力,以及更加容易修改程式編程。
它的記憶體容量是 EEC-IV
四倍,現代汽車也需要這些額外的容量去管控像是循跡控制、氣囊、定速等功能,並使用新的 104 Pin
連接器,以容納更多感知器和作動器的訊號,以控制引擎和變速箱。
EEC-VI:
最新一代的 EEC-VI 電腦,採用了 32
位元的 MPC555 微處理器。
整個系統藉由 CAN
匯流排控制著所有車上先進的裝置,運算速度的大幅增進,加上更大的記憶體容量,使得整個引擎監理系統能有最佳的表現。 |